Or. Admin. Code § 331-900-0095 - Earlobe Piercing Practice Standards and Prohibitions
(1) An earlobe piercing license holder must:
(a) Use an earlobe piercing system that
pierces an individual's earlobe by use of a sterile, encapsulated single-use
stud with clasp;
(b) Use an earlobe
piercing system made of non-absorbent and non-porous material which can be
cleaned and disinfected, using a high level disinfectant according to
manufacturer's instructions;
(c)
Use single-use prepackaged sterilized ear piercing studs for each client;
(d) Store new or disinfected
earlobe piercing systems in a clean disinfected location, using a high level
disinfectant according to manufacturer's instructions, and store separately
from used or soiled instruments;
(e) Ensure equipment used during an earlobe
procedure is disinfected, using a high level disinfectant according to
manufacturer's instructions, following service on each client.
(f) Cover the handle of the earlobe piercing
system with a new cover before a service is provided to a client.
(2) An earlobe piercer may only
pierce with an earlobe piercing system; use of a needle is
prohibited.
(3) An earlobe piercing
system may only be used to pierce the earlobe. Use of an earlobe piercing
system on other parts of the body or ear is prohibited.
(4) Piercing with a manual loaded spring
operated ear piercing system is prohibited.
(5) Piercing the earlobe with any type of
piercing system which does not use the pre-sterilized encapsulated stud and
clasp system is prohibited.
(6)
Earlobe Piercing is prohibited:
(a) On a
person under 18 years of age unless the requirements of OAR
331-900-0099 are met;
(b) On a person who shows
signs of being inebriated or appears to be incapacitated by the use of alcohol
or drugs; and
(c) On a person with
sunburn or other skin diseases or disorders of the skin such as open lesions,
rashes, wounds, puncture marks in areas of treatment.
